Web3 jan. 2024 · Start the description (three to four sentences should do it) with the outcome of the turn that just transpired, show how it affected the battlefield at large, then prompt the next player to action! Here’s an example: “Another ghoul lies slain at Alaric’s feet. The necromancer eyes him fiercely, chanting in Abyssal and tracing something in the air.
